Sign in
All
Images
Videos
Maps
News
Shopping
More
Flights
Travel
Hotels
Search
Notebook
Grand Prairie Illuvia at Epic Central
Recommended Searches
EpicCentral
2961 S Highway 161, Grand Prairie, TX 75052
(800) 288-8386
Illuvia Water Show At Epic Central Park
2961 State Hwy 161, Grand Prairie, TX 75052
(800) 288-8386